Budget (including currency): £2500

Country: United Kingdom

Games, programs or workloads that it will be used for: Project Zomboid, GTA, Sims 4, mostly indie games

Other details (existing parts lists, whether any peripherals are needed, what you're upgrading from, when you're going to buy, what resolution and refresh rate you want to play at, etc): 
I am building a setup for my fiance for our to-be gaming room the only reason I'm upgrading hers is because she is on a 2014 office PC that can't run much of anything anymore. I have done a part list but I need some advice on it is it a good build or should I swap some stuff out?
my budget isn't set it can go up or down 🙂

PCPartPicker Part List

CPU: *AMD Ryzen 7 7800X3D 4.2 GHz 8-Core Processor  (£317.00 @ Amazon UK) 
CPU Cooler: *Deepcool AG620 WH ARGB 67.88 CFM CPU Cooler  (£64.98 @ Amazon UK) 
Motherboard: *Asus ROG STRIX B650-A GAMING WIFI ATX AM5 Motherboard  (£199.98 @ Amazon UK) 
Memory: TEAMGROUP T-Force Delta RGB 32 GB (2 x 16 GB) DDR5-6000 CL30 Memory  (£113.98 @ Overclockers.co.uk) 
Storage: *Samsung 990 Pro 2 TB M.2-2280 PCIe 4.0 X4 NVME Solid State Drive  (£159.99 @ CCL Computers) 
Video Card: *Zotac GAMING Trinity OC GeForce RTX 4070 Ti SUPER 16 GB Video Card  (£809.99 @ AWD-IT) 
Case: *Lian Li LANCOOL 216 RGB ATX Mid Tower Case  (£105.00 @ Computer Orbit) 
Power Supply: *MSI MAG A850GL PCIE5 850 W 80+ Gold Certified Fully Modular ATX Power Supply  (£119.49 @ Amazon UK) 
Total: £1890.41

I feel like if you are going to spend that much on an NVMe SSD, might as well go all out with a Gen5:

 

PCPartPicker Part List: https://uk.pcpartpicker.com/list/VhB96D

 

CPU: *AMD Ryzen 7 7800X3D 4.2 GHz 8-Core Processor  (£317.00 @ Amazon UK) 
CPU Cooler: ID-COOLING FROZN A620 ARGB 78 CFM CPU Cooler  (£49.99 @ Amazon UK) 
Motherboard: MSI PRO B650-S WIFI ATX AM5 Motherboard  (£139.97 @ Amazon UK) 
Memory: Corsair Vengeance RGB 32 GB (2 x 16 GB) DDR5-6000 CL30 Memory  (£121.99 @ Amazon UK) 
Storage: MSI SPATIUM M570 HS 2 TB M.2-2280 PCIe 5.0 X4 NVME Solid State Drive  (£233.06 @ Amazon UK) 
Video Card: ASRock Phantom Gaming OC Radeon RX 7900 XTX 24 GB Video Card  (£861.49 @ NeoComputers) 
Case: Corsair 4000D Airflow ATX Mid Tower Case  (£79.00 @ Computer Orbit) 
Power Supply: Antec NeoECO Gold 850 W 80+ Gold Certified Fully Modular ATX Power Supply  (£89.98 @ MoreCoCo) 
 

Total: £1892.48
